В качестве интерфейса в компьютере
Поможем в ✍️ написании учебной работы
Поможем с курсовой, контрольной, дипломной, рефератом, отчетом по практике, научно-исследовательской и любой другой работой

Внимание разработчиков HP фокусировалось на оснащении интерфейсом цифровой измерительной аппаратуры, проектировщики особо не планировали делать IEEE-488 интерфейсом периферийных устройств для универсальных компьютеров. Но когда первым микрокомпьютерам HP потребовался интерфейс для перефирии (жёстким дискам, НКМЛ, принтерам, плоттерам, и т. д.), HP-IB был с готовностью доступен и легко приспособлен для достижения этой цели.

Компьютеры производимые HP использовали HP-IB, например HP 9800 , серии HP 2100, и серии HP 3000[15]. Некоторые из инженерных калькуляторов, выпускаемых HP в 1980х, такие как серии HP-41 и HP-71B, также имели возможность использования IEEE-488, через необязательный интерфейсный модуль HP-IL/HP-IB.

Другие изготовители также приняли универсальную интерфейсную шину для своих компьютеров, как например линейка Tektronix 405x.

Commodore PET расширивший в 1977 список персональных компьютеров, использовавший шину IEEE-488 но с нестандартным соединителем платы для подключения своих внешних устройств. Commodore наследовал восьмибитные компьютеры такие как VIC-20, C-64 и C-128, в которых применялся последовательный интерфейс, использующий круглый соединитель DIN, для которого они сохранили программирование интерфейса и терминологии IEEE-488.

Пока скорость шины IEEE-488 была увеличена для некоторых приложений до 10 МБ/сек, отсутствие стандартов командного протокола ограничило сторонние предложения и функциональную совместимость. В конечном итоге, более быстрые, более полные стандарты, такие как например SCSI заменили IEEE-488 в периферийных устройствах.

 

Шина КОП

Шина IEEE-488 и соответствующий протокол широко используются в программно-аппаратных комплексах для соединения персональных компьютеров и рабочих станций с измерительными инструментами (в частности, в системах сбора данных). Разработанный в 60-х годах в Hewlett-Packard, протокол изначально назывался HPIB (Hewlett-Packard Interace Bus, интерфейсная шина Hewlett-Packard). Впоследствии другие компании подхватили инициативу и начали использовать протокол для своих внутренних целей. Протокол был стандартизован американским Институтом инженеров электротехнической и электронной промышленности (IEEE) и переименован в IEEE-488 (по номеру стандарта) или GPIB (General Purpose Interface Bus, интерфейсная шина общего назначения) в середине 70-х годов. Аналогичный российский стандарт называется Канал Общего Пользования (КОП).

 

Шина IEEE-488 - это надежный и эффективный канал передачи данных. Простота использования, непрекращающееся развитие аппартной поддержки GPIB, разработка новых интерфейсных карточек и GPIB-совместимых инструментов ведут к неуклонному росту числа пользователей шины, несмотря на мощную конкуренцию со стороны архитектур VMEbus и FiberChannel. В последние несколько лет индустрия GPIB эволюционирует в направлении минимизации затрат на изготовление при сохранении базисной функциональности шины. Это достигается путем использования недорогих микроконтроллеров для реализации устройств типа "говорящий" и "слушатель".

 

 

Шина КОП состоит из 24 проводов, назначение которых в стандартном разъеме.

 

Все сигнальные линии используют отрицательную логику: наибольшее положительное напряжение интерпретируется как логический "0", а наибольшее отрицательное -- как логическая "1". Конкретные значения напряжения определены стандартом IEEE-488.

 

Сигнальные линии шины относятся к одному из трех классов:

- линии данных,

- линии "рукопожатия" (синхронизации) и

- линии управления интерфейсом.

 

Для пересылки команд по шине используются восемь линий данных, причем старший бит (DIO8) в большинстве случаев игнорируется.

 

Три линии синхронизации обеспечивают передачу данных и команд и обеспечивают гарантированный прием данных всеми устройствами типа "слушатель" в надлежащее время.

 

 

Дата: 2019-12-10, просмотров: 190.